        <title>Tarot De Muerto - Tarot of the Dead</title>
        <link rel="alternate" type="text/html" href="http://thestarryeye.typepad.com/tarot/2009/11/tarot-de-muerto-tarot-of-the-dead.html" />
        <link rel="replies" type="text/html" href="http://thestarryeye.typepad.com/tarot/2009/11/tarot-de-muerto-tarot-of-the-dead.html" thr:count="0" />
        <id>tag:typepad.com,2003:post-6a00d8341cdd0d53ef0120a69df404970c</id>
        <published>2009-11-01T21:00:00-05:00</published>
        <updated>2009-11-01T19:04:47-05:00</updated>
        <summary>Tarot de Muerto: Tarot of the Dead. This deck is based on the Mexican holiday Day of the Dead. Every November 2nd Mexicans honor those who have passed on. That is the theme of this deck. The artist, Monica Knighton first created this deck in the mid 1990’s. It is her take on the classic Rider-Waite deck, but her beautiful water color drawings are whimsical and filled with detail.
